TOLD Foundation is a private grantmaking foundation located in Camarillo, California. Established in 2011, the foundation operates as a 501(c)(3) charitable organization with a focus on supporting education, philanthropy, and human services initiatives.

Under IRS private-foundation payout rules, Told Foundation reported a distributable amount of $3.0M for 2024 — the minimum it must pay out in qualifying distributions.

Mission & Focus Areas

The foundation's primary funding areas include:

  • Arts education grants
  • Youth development, particularly through the Conejo Valley YMCA
  • Education and STEM education initiatives
  • Science education and teacher support
  • Unrestricted campaign grants
  • The Howard & Mary Wennes Hunger Leadership Endowment
  • Student support programs

How much is Told Foundation required to give away each year?

Private foundations must generally distribute about 5% of their assets annually. For 2024, Told Foundation reported a distributable amount of $3.0M on its IRS Form 990-PF — the minimum it must pay out in qualifying distributions.
